Separatism

In an Associated Press story about union interest in charter schools, there is this from American Federation of Teachers President Randi Weingarten:

Weingarten said the charter school movement would expand more rapidly if supporters were more open to collective bargaining.

“The promise of charter schools is that they are small incubators of experimentation, both in terms of instruction and labor relations,” she said. “They shouldn’t be separate systems.”

And fortunately, thanks to the Niagara Gazette, we know exactly what she means.
